Description
Using previously described functional techniques for some non–perturbative, gauge invariant, renormalized QCD processes, a simplified version of the amplitudes — in which forms akin to Pomerons naturally appear — provides fits to ISR and LHC–TOTEM pp elastic scattering data. Those amplitudes rely on a specific function φ(b) which describes the fluctuations of the transverse position of quarks inside hadrons.
